| Perennial Zone 7 | Thailand Giant Elephant Ear | |
| Perennial plant | ![]() |
|
| Full sun to part sun | ||
| Medium water requirments early and pretty drought tolerant once plant is established | ||
| 48-100 inches tall and spreading | ||
| leaves are large and green | ||
| You can use liquid fertilizer every other week or a slow release fertilizer a couple of times a season | ||
| This plant is very easy to grow it will tolerate all types of soil and watering |

| This plant is available from spring to summer | Thailand Giant elephant ear has the largest ears up to 4 ft wide and 6 foot long all on a plant that grows up to 10 feet tall, can be potted in a large container or plant in the ground for maximum size. | |
